Architecture and the City Festival-- San Francisco

If you're like me, you can't help but peek into any bare windows and wonder what a house looks like inside.  And when that home was designed by an architect with meticulous detail, it's all the more tempting!  Well, thanks to Architecture and the City by the American Institute of Architects (AIA), if you're in San Fran, you can learn more though lectures and events to get lots of ideas for your own home!

Erin Cullerton, Assistant Director with AIA-San Francisco, is as passionate about this month as they come.  With all the great opportunities to see spectacular design this month, I'm excited too!

I also had a chance to catch up with one of the featured architects, Sarah Wilmer of Studio Sarah Wilmer.  One of her projects was featured on the home tour.   Take a look!
 

If you're in another town, reach out to your local chapter of AIA to see when an architectural celebration is coming to your town!
